Understanding FedEx International Economy Shipping

FedEx International Economy is a shipping service that offers delivery for non-urgent shipments at a lower cost compared to other shipping options. This shipping method can be used for packages weighing up to 150 pounds, with a maximum length of 108 inches and a total of 165 inches in length and girth combined.

One of the benefits of using FedEx International Economy is that it provides reliable tracking information for your package. You can easily track your shipment online and receive updates on its location and estimated delivery date. Additionally, this shipping method includes customs clearance, which can help simplify the process of shipping internationally.

It is important to note that FedEx International Economy may not be the best option for time-sensitive shipments. While it is a cost-effective shipping method, it may take longer for your package to arrive compared to other shipping options. If you need your package to arrive quickly, you may want to consider using FedEx International Priority or another expedited shipping service.

Understanding Customs Clearance for FedEx International Economy Shipments

Customs clearance is a critical process that all international shipments must go through. When shipping with FedEx International Economy, it’s crucial to understand the customs clearance requirements for your package’s destination country. Customs clearance can cause delays to packages, and it’s essential to ensure that all necessary documentation is included to avoid delays.

One important aspect of customs clearance is the assessment of duties and taxes. Depending on the destination country and the contents of the package, duties and taxes may be assessed by customs officials. It’s important to research the duty and tax rates for the destination country before shipping to avoid any unexpected fees.

Another factor to consider is the potential for customs inspections. Customs officials may inspect packages to ensure that they comply with all regulations and laws. This can also cause delays in delivery, so it’s important to ensure that all necessary documentation is included and that the package complies with all regulations for the destination country.

One common issue that may arise when using FedEx International Economy is lost packages. While this is a rare occurrence, it can happen due to various reasons such as incorrect address, damaged package, or theft. In such cases, it is important to contact FedEx customer care immediately to file a claim and initiate a search for the lost package.

Another issue that may arise is unexpected fees or duties charged by customs. This can happen if the package contains items that are restricted or prohibited in the destination country, or if the declared value of the package is incorrect. To avoid such issues, it is important to research the customs regulations of the destination country and accurately declare the contents and value of the package.
